How to Make Kicked Up Chicken Salad Sandwiches

  1. Hard-boil 2 large eggs. While eggs boil, drain two 5-ounce cans of chicken breast and shred the chicken into a medium mixing bowl.
  2. Add 1/2 cup mayonnaise, 1/4 cup finely chopped red onion, 2 tablespoons sweet pickle relish, 1-2 jalapeños (finely minced, adjust to your spice preference), 1/2 teaspoon salt, and 1/4 teaspoon black pepper.
  3. Once eggs are cooked, peel and dice them. Add the diced eggs and 4 slices of cooked and crumbled bacon to the bowl.
  4. Gently mix all ingredients until well combined.
  5. Serve the chicken salad on toasted bread. For an extra crunch and freshness, top with lettuce leaves.
